Water is moving at a speed of 7.55 m/s through a fire hose with an internal diameter of 5.99 cm. When the water exits through a nozzle it is traveling at a speed of 35.9 m/s.
A) What is the flow rate of water in the hose?
B) What is the diameter of the nozzle?
C) What is the gauge pressure of water in the hose?
